"Dawn of the Century" March & Two-Step, sheet music cover
Description
An account of the resource
Cover artwork shows allegorical woman holding a standard identifying her as "XXth Century". She has an electric light bulb atop her head and stands on a winged wheel, representing Progress. Around her are examples of modern technology and invention, including a typewriter, telegraph key, electric streetcar, dynamo, engine, telephone, sewing machine, camera, printing press, locomotive, and "horseless carriage" type automobile.

Western Electric Company multiple switchboard
Description
An account of the resource
In order to handle increasing numbers of telephone calls, switchboards like this model from the 1880s employed operators to make connections between the parties. (Click on the image for diagrams illustrating the difference between single-line wires and a switched circuit.)
